Chemical Composition of Holographic Polish

Holographic nail polish is known for its eye-catching, iridescent finish that creates a rainbow-like effect under light. This unique appearance is achieved through a combination of specialized chemical components. The primary ingredient in holographic polish is a suspension of microscopic, light-reflective particles, typically made from materials like aluminum, titanium dioxide, or synthetic fluorophlogopite. These particles are coated with a thin layer of metal oxides, such as aluminum oxide or iron oxide, which refract and diffract light to produce the holographic effect. Unlike traditional glitter polishes, these particles are finer and more uniform, ensuring a smoother application and minimizing potential damage to the nail surface.

The base of holographic nail polish is similar to that of conventional nail lacquers, consisting of solvents, film-forming agents, and resins. Solvents like ethyl acetate and butyl acetate act as carriers for the other ingredients, evaporating upon application to leave behind a solid coating. Film-forming agents, such as nitrocellulose or tosylamide/formaldehyde resin, create a flexible yet durable film on the nail. Resins, including polyurethanes or acrylics, enhance adhesion and provide a glossy finish. While these components are standard in most nail polishes, their formulation in holographic polishes is carefully balanced to ensure the reflective particles remain evenly distributed without settling at the bottom of the bottle.

One concern regarding holographic nail polish is the presence of potentially harmful chemicals, such as formaldehyde, toluene, and dibutyl phthalate (DBP), which are sometimes used in nail polish formulations. However, many modern holographic polishes are marketed as "3-free" or "10-free," meaning they are formulated without these toxic substances. Instead, safer alternatives like triphenyl phosphate (TPHP) or benzophenone-1 are used as plasticizers and UV stabilizers. Despite these advancements, it is still essential to check the ingredient list, as some holographic polishes may contain allergens or irritants like methacrylates or camphor.

Application and Removal Effects

Holographic nail polish has gained popularity for its stunning, iridescent effects, but concerns about its impact on nail health persist. The application process itself is similar to regular nail polish, but the key lies in the quality of the product and the technique used. When applying holographic nail polish, it’s essential to start with a clean, dry nail surface. Begin by applying a base coat to protect the nails from potential staining or damage. Allow the base coat to dry completely before applying the holographic polish. Most holographic polishes require multiple thin coats to achieve the desired effect, as opposed to one thick coat, which can lead to uneven application and longer drying times. Proper application ensures that the polish adheres well and minimizes the risk of chipping or peeling, which can inadvertently cause nail damage.

The removal process is where holographic nail polish can pose a risk to nail health if not done correctly. Holographic polishes often contain fine particles that create their signature shimmer, making them more difficult to remove than standard nail polishes. Using regular nail polish remover may require excessive rubbing, which can weaken the nails and cause dryness or brittleness. To mitigate this, opt for a acetone-based remover, which is more effective at breaking down the polish. Soaking a cotton pad in remover, placing it on the nail, and wrapping it in foil for 10–15 minutes can help dissolve the polish without aggressive scrubbing. Additionally, using a gentle, wooden cuticle stick to lift the softened polish can reduce the need for forceful removal.

Improper removal techniques, such as peeling off the polish or using low-quality removers, can strip the nails of their natural oils and leave them vulnerable to damage. Peeling off holographic polish can also remove the top layer of the nail, leading to thinning and weakening over time. To maintain nail health, it’s crucial to follow removal with hydration. After taking off the polish, wash your hands thoroughly to remove any residue, and apply a nourishing cuticle oil or hand cream to replenish moisture. This step is particularly important if acetone-based removers were used, as acetone can be drying.

Comparison with Regular Nail Polish

When comparing holographic nail polish to regular nail polish, it's essential to consider the formulation and potential effects on nail health. Holographic nail polishes often contain specialized pigments that create a rainbow or prism-like effect when exposed to light. These pigments can sometimes require a slightly different chemical composition compared to standard nail polishes. Regular nail polishes typically use traditional colorants and may have a simpler formula, which often includes a base, color pigments, and a topcoat. The key difference lies in the additives and the intensity of the ingredients used to achieve the holographic effect.

One concern regarding holographic nail polish is the possibility of increased chemical exposure. Some holographic polishes may contain higher levels of certain compounds, such as aluminum or specialized polymers, to enhance the holographic effect. In contrast, regular nail polishes usually have a more standardized formula with well-studied ingredients. However, it's important to note that both types of nail polishes can contain potentially harmful chemicals like formaldehyde, toluene, and dibutyl phthalate (DBP), often referred to as the "toxic trio." The presence of these chemicals is not exclusive to holographic polishes but is a concern across the nail polish industry.

In terms of nail damage, the application and removal process plays a significant role. Holographic nail polishes might require a specific base coat or application technique to ensure the holographic effect is prominent. This could potentially lead to more layers of polish on the nail, which may increase the risk of nail dehydration or weakening if not properly managed. Regular nail polishes, on the other hand, are generally more forgiving and can be applied with standard techniques. However, frequent application and removal of any nail polish, regardless of type, can lead to nail dryness and brittleness if proper nail care is not maintained.

The durability of holographic nail polish is another factor to consider. Due to its unique composition, holographic polish may have a different wear time compared to regular polish. Some users report that holographic polishes can chip or wear off faster, leading to more frequent reapplication. This increased frequency of application and removal can potentially stress the nails more than regular polish, which might last longer and require less maintenance. However, this can vary widely depending on the brand and quality of the polish.
